DGR coilovers write up
So I was in need of some coilovers and although I didnt know much about DGR and there were not many write ups about there pro's and con's, i decided to jump on that group buy and purchase the track set with a spring rate of 13k/11k. First off the main thing that made me end up going with DGR in the end was the amazing customer service offered and there quick response to phone calls/emails. He is an extremely friendly guy and has no problem answering questions small or big.
The box came waaaay earlier then he said which was a great start off lol. The coilovers, much like other DGR write ups that u may have read, came very well packed with no damage to them what so ever. There finish was flawless, and i personally like the orange and black color scheme. It came with all the parts and tools he tells u he is sending and it came with instructions aswell.
The actual install was confusing but it was only on my part, I have swapped out struts on cars all day long but i didnt realize the complexity of coilovers as far as putting them in with the correct preload etc. I called him up and he walked me threw it over the phone and even emailed me detail instructions which was nice to see a company do. After installing and finally setting everything up properly i had plenty of room to lower it more. I use the car for auto cross so I didnt slam it as some other members prefer to do but if I wanted to I could go waaaaaaay lower.
After my first autocross event my impression is the same, they are amazing. you can see a difference between the adjustments up top. Alot of people were concerned about running the track set as a daily driver but i honestly have no problem, it goes over pot holes smooth as hell but when it comes to hard turns it sticks to the ground as you would expect them to. I highly recommend these coilovers, I have ridden in other peoples s2's that have kwv3's and tein mono flex and i could confidently say they feel identical, which if u take into consideration their much lower price, there warranty and amazing customer service its a no brainer for me, if i had to do it over again i would get them again without a second thought.
